Historic architecture, bicyclists, and towering trees come together to make Corvallis, Oregon a fascinating and exciting city. Dating back to 1845, the city is best known as the home of Oregon State University, but Corvallis is much more than a college town. With nearly 50 parks, Corvallis is a Tree City USA, and the League of American Bicyclists rate Corvallis as gold -- 12 percent of residents ride a bicycle to school or work every day.
Oregon State University is a major draw to the city. This highly-respected university is a land-, sea-, space-, and sun-grant institution and is one of just 73 land-grant universities in the country. OSU was established in 1868, and residents of Corvallis can cheer on the OSU Beavers at Reser Stadium (football), Goss Stadium (basketball), and Gill Stadium (baseball).
